water Review Anthropogenic Changes in a Mediterranean Coastal Wetland during the Last Century—The Case of Gialova Lagoon, Messinia, Greece Giorgos Maneas 1,2,*, Eirini Makopoulou 1, Dimitris Bousbouras 3, Håkan Berg 1 and Stefano Manzoni 1,4 1 Department of Physical Geography, Stockholm University, 10691 Stockholm, Sweden; [email protected] (E.M.); [email protected] (H.B.); [email protected] (S.M.) 2 Navarino Environmental Observatory, 24001 SW Messinia, Greece 3 Hellenic Ornithological Society, 10681 Athens, Greece; [email protected] 4 Bolin Centre for Climate Research, 10691 Stockholm, Sweden * Correspondence: [email protected]; Tel.: +30-6979809570 Received: 16 December 2018; Accepted: 12 February 2019; Published: 19 February 2019 Abstract: Human interventions during the last 70 years have altered the characteristics of the Gialova Lagoon, a coastal wetland that is part of a wider Natura 2000 site. In this study, we explore how human interventions and climate altered the wetland’s hydrological conditions and habitats, leading to changing wetland functions over time. Our interpretations are based on a mixed methodological approach combining conceptual hydrologic models, analysis of aerial photographs, local knowledge, field observations, and GIS (Geographic Information System) analyses. The results show that the combined effects of human interventions and climate have led to increased salinity in the wetland over time. As a result, the fresh and brackish water marshes have gradually been turned into open water or replaced by halophytic vegetation with profound ecological implications. Furthermore, current human activities inside the Natura 2000 area and in the surrounding areas could further impact on the water quantity and quality in the wetland, and on its sensitive ecosystems. -

water Review Biogeochemistry of Mediterranean Wetlands: A Review about the Effects of Water-Level Fluctuations on Phosphorus Cycling and Greenhouse Gas Emissions Inmaculada de Vicente 1,2 1 Departamento de Ecología, Universidad de Granada, 18071 Granada, Spain; [email protected]; Tel.: +34-95-824-9768 2 Instituto del Agua, Universidad de Granada, 18071 Granada, Spain Abstract: Although Mediterranean wetlands are characterized by extreme natural water level fluctu- ations in response to irregular precipitation patterns, global climate change is expected to amplify this pattern by shortening precipitation seasons and increasing the incidence of summer droughts in this area. As a consequence, a part of the lake sediment will be exposed to air-drying in dry years when the water table becomes low. This periodic sediment exposure to dry/wet cycles will likely affect biogeochemical processes. Unexpectedly, to date, few studies are focused on assessing the effects of water level fluctuations on the biogeochemistry of these ecosystems. In this review, we investigate the potential impacts of water level fluctuations on phosphorus dynamics and on greenhouse gases emissions in Mediterranean wetlands. Major drivers of global change, and specially water level fluctuations, will lead to the degradation of water quality in Mediterranean wetlands by increasing the availability of phosphorus concentration in the water column upon rewetting of dry sediment. CO2 fluxes are likely to be enhanced during desiccation, while inundation is likely to decrease cumulative CO emissions, as well as N O emissions, although increasing CH emissions. (33) 4 67 04 71 00 Fax (33) 4 67 04 71 01 0 ABSTRACT Wetlands are rich and diverse ecosystems. They provide numerous ecosystem services and important, noteworthy hydrological and ecological, functions. International conventions and national legislations provide a comprehensive set of official commitments to their preservation. Wetlands’ preservation is also highly recommended by scientific communities and international organisations. Most Mediterranean wetlands have been historically drained for water-borne disease and agricultural uses. Remaining wetlands are currently heavily threatened by physical alteration and by drastic hydrological changes. An important challenge for the long term preservation of water resources in the Mediterranean lays in finding ways of securing appropriate allocation of water to wetlands.
